At Goneke Investment Group (GIG), our approach to infrastructure investing is firmly rooted in a long-term buy-and-hold strategy, designed to deliver stable, enduring capital appreciation alongside consistent, predictable cash flow. We recognize that large-scale infrastructure assets—such as power plants, highways, or urban developments—are not short-term speculations but foundational pillars of economic ecosystems, requiring patience and foresight to maximize their potential. This philosophy distinguishes us from peers who chase quick flips, positioning us as stewards of assets that generate value over decades rather than years.
Our focus on longevity is particularly suited to the infrastructure landscape of AfCFTA countries and emerging markets, where assets often require sustained investment to mature. For example, a solar energy project in Tanzania might take years to stabilize its grid integration and customer base, but once operational, it delivers decades of reliable cash flow and community benefits. Similarly, a transportation corridor linking coastal ports to inland cities—like the Dar es Salaam-to-Kigali route—requires upfront capital and regulatory navigation but promises steady returns as trade volumes grow under AfCFTA. By committing to these long-term horizons, we ensure sustainable returns for our investors, balancing immediate yield with future appreciation.
This approach also fosters resilience, enabling our Funds to weather economic cycles and geopolitical shifts. We bring a disciplined, value-add mindset to every infrastructure investment, emphasizing operational excellence, transparency, and accountability as cornerstones of our strategy. This approach begins with our rigorous due diligence process, where we dissect every facet of a potential investment—financial health, operational efficiency, market dynamics, and growth prospects—to identify opportunities for enhancement. But our work doesn’t stop at acquisition; it’s just the beginning of a transformative journey. Throughout the investment lifecycle, we work closely with our partners—management teams, local stakeholders, and industrial collaborators—to unlock untapped potential and drive meaningful growth. For instance, in a food infrastructure asset, we might implement precision agriculture technologies to boost yields, streamline supply chains to reduce waste, and negotiate better distribution contracts to expand market reach—all while maintaining transparent reporting to our investors. In a real estate project, we could enhance value by introducing energy-efficient designs, securing anchor tenants, or rezoning land for higher-value use, turning a modest asset into a thriving hub.
Our hands-on involvement ensures that every dollar invested translates into tangible improvements. We embed operational experts within portfolio companies, providing strategic guidance on everything from cost optimization to workforce training, and we hold ourselves accountable to clear performance metrics—whether it’s revenue growth, carbon footprint reduction, or job creation.
